BNSF Railway is looking to transform their data assets into a real-time enterprise by leveraging AI and machine learning to optimize railroad operations, including predictive maintenance, scheduling, and safety monitoring.

Requirements

  • Proficiency in programming languages such as Python or Java.
  • Familiarity with data engineering tools and platforms (e.g., Hadoop, Spark, EMS, AWS S3, PySpark, RDS, JupyterLab) and cloud services (AWS, Azure, Databricks) and open source environments.
  • Familiarity with machine learning frameworks (e.g., TensorFlow, PyTorch, scikit-learn, Keras).
  • Understanding of databases and SQL for data management.
  • Basic knowledge of data visualization tools (e.g., Tableau, PowerBI, TIBCO)
  • Experience with IoT devices, sensors, or edge computing in industrial environments.
  • Experience with GIS data.

Responsibilities

  • Assist in designing, developing, and implementing AI models and algorithms tailored to railroad operations, including predictive maintenance, scheduling, and safety monitoring.
  • Collaborate with senior engineers to apply machine learning techniques to analyze large datasets and extract actionable insights.
  • Collect, preprocess, and clean data from various sources (e.g., sensors, GPS, maintenance logs) for training AI models.
  • Conduct exploratory data analysis to identify trends and patterns relevant to rail operations.
  • Building and maintaining Extract, Transform, Load (ETL) pipelines for AI applications
  • Work in partnership with data scientists to develop AI-driven solutions to optimize train scheduling, route planning, and fuel efficiency.
  • Participate in testing and optimization of AI models to ensure accuracy, reliability, and compliance with safety standards.
